In moving onto a new LoZ game and giving OOT a rest, I've decided to rank the 5 main temples in the game. Let's see how they stack up:

5. Spirit Temple
Ironically, Water Temple was NOT the temple to make me rage. Spirit temple was, and the reason why is because of Young Link's half of the temple. In other dungeons, whenever puzzles were completed they would be completed forever and I wouldn't have to re-do them (as long as I saved my progress). With the Spirit Temple though, even with saving progress a ton, whenever I lost against Iron Knuckle I would have to re-do most of the puzzles in order to get back to his room. I don't know why this is necessary, especially since in other dungeons every puzzle I encountered wouldn't reset. But with the sun tiles and bombchus and all...different story. Not to mention Young Link has pathetic range compared to Adult Link, which makes fighting more tedious. I get that it's supposed to be the hardest temple, but the resets of the puzzles I find to be completely unnecessary and aggravating.

4. Water Temple
Nope, Water Temple isn't last. It's because I play the 3ds version so the paths are a little easier to follow. With that being said though, it can still be frustrating to navigate through the water and back-track (and there's a lot of back-tracking in this temple). Everything moves slower (as per typical water levels) and other temples I just find to be more interesting. I will say though; I LOVE the shadow Link fight (also, I found it to be surprisingly easy. Is that just me?)

3. Forest Temple
Fun puzzles and an easy dungeon, but I don't remember much about it. I remember the mini-boss being frustrating since cameras in small rooms don't work too well in OOT, but for the most part it was an enjoyable early challenge.

2. Shadow Temple
This temple was VERY close to beating Fire temple, but I can't do it. Fire temple is the one that I'm definitely most likely to re-play, but I'll explain that in a bit. Anyway, Shadow temple is enjoyable. The challenge is there but it's hard for the right reasons (it doesn't feel cheap), and the gimmicks in it make this temple stand out in uniqueness.

1. Fire Temple
Fire temple <3 I love this dungeon. Yes, there's some back-tracking that can take away from enjoyment, but overall I love this temple. The platforming is programmed for a Zelda game, the enemies are somewhat challenging but not necessarily frustrating, the puzzles enhance the dungeon, and I really enjoyed the boss-fight against the dragon. So far, the dragon fight has been my favorite boss fight in OOT aside from Shadow Link. This temple is the single temple in the game that I can see myself re-playing just for the heck of it.
